repo.or.cz
/
official-gcc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Add missing <experimental/numeric> header to docs
2018-08-08
redi
Add missing <experimental/numeric>
heade
r
to docs
commit
|
commitdiff
|
tree
2018-08-08
r
e
di
PR libstdc++/86597
direct
o
ry_entry ob
s
ervers should
.
.
.
commit
|
commitdiff
|
tree
2018-08-07
r
e
di
PR l
i
bstdc++/86874 fix std::
v
ariant::swap
r
egression
commit
|
commitdiff
|
tree
2018-08-07
redi
PR libs
t
dc++
/
86861 Meet preconditio
n
for S
o
l
a
r
is memal
i
gn
commit
|
commitdiff
|
tree
2018-08-07
re
d
i
D
efi
n
e monotoni
c
_buf
f
er_resource member
s
o
u
t-of
-
lin
e
commit
|
commitdiff
|
tree
2018-08-03
redi
Add workaround
for non-unique errno va
l
ues on
A
I
X
commit
|
commitdiff
|
tree
2018-08-01
redi
Add -D_GLIBCXX_A
S
S
E
R
TIONS to DEBUG_FLAGS
commit
|
commitdiff
|
tree
2018-08-01
redi
Use steady_clock to
i
mplement condit
i
on_
v
a
r
i
ab
l
e::wai
t
_for
commit
|
commitdiff
|
tree
2018-08-01
redi
Report early wakeup of condi
t
ion
_
variable::wait_u
n
til
.
.
.
commit
|
commitdiff
|
tree
2018-08-01
redi
P
R
libstdc++/60555 std::system_
c
ategory() should recogn
i
se
.
.
.
commit
|
commitdiff
|
tree
2018-07-31
redi
PR l
i
bstdc+
+
/86751 d
e
f
a
ult
a
s
si
g
n
m
e
n
t operators for
.
.
.
commit
|
commitdiff
|
tree
2018-07-31
redi
Don
'
t unc
o
ndit
i
onall
y
define feat
u
re test
macr
o
s
i
n
.
.
.
commit
|
commitdiff
|
tree
2018-07-31
redi
Impr
o
ve libstdc++ docs w
.
r
.
t newer
C
+
+
standard
s
commit
|
commitdiff
|
tree
2018-07-31
redi
Replace safe
b
ool idi
o
m with
explicit operator bool
commit
|
commitdiff
|
tree
2018-07-30
redi
PR
l
ibstdc++/86734
make reverse
_
it
e
rato
r
::operator
.
.
.
commit
|
commitdiff
|
tree
2018-07-30
redi
Add workaround for ali
g
n
e
d_alloc bug on AIX
commit
|
commitdiff
|
tree
2018-07-26
redi
Add miss
i
ng dg-require-cst
d
int
directives to t
e
sts
commit
|
commitdiff
|
tree
2018-07-26
r
ed
i
Re
m
ove dg-require-cstdint dir
e
c
t
ive from tests
commit
|
commitdiff
|
tree
2018-07-26
redi
Remove dg-
r
equire-cstdin
t
directiv
e
f
r
om t
e
sts
commit
|
commitdiff
|
tree
2018-07-26
redi
Rem
o
ve dg-re
q
u
ire-
c
stdint di
r
ective fr
o
m
tests
commit
|
commitdiff
|
tree
2018-07-26
redi
Add missin
g
check
s
for _GLIBCXX_USE_C99
_
ST
D
I
N
T_
T
R
1
commit
|
commitdiff
|
tree
2018-07-26
redi
Modi
f
y
some librar
y
internals to work
without <stdint
.
h>
commit
|
commitdiff
|
tree
2018-07-26
redi
Remove cha
r
16_t an
d
c
har3
2
_t dependency on <stdi
n
t
.
h
>
commit
|
commitdiff
|
tree
2018-07-26
r
edi
Remove <c
h
rono> dependency on _GLIB
C
XX_USE_C
9
9_STDINT_T
R
1
commit
|
commitdiff
|
tree
2018-07-25
redi
P
R
libstdc++/86676 anothe
r
alignment fix for test
commit
|
commitdiff
|
tree
2018-07-25
redi
P
R
l
i
b
stdc+
+
/8667
6
Do
not a
s
sume stack b
u
f
f
e
r is aligned
commit
|
commitdiff
|
tree
2018-07-25
redi
Add missi
n
g header for std::max_align_t
commit
|
commitdiff
|
tree
2018-07-25
redi
Add new src/c++17 d
i
r
e
cto
r
y
t
o
l
ist i
n
acin
c
lude
.
m4
commit
|
commitdiff
|
tree
2018-07-25
re
d
i
Move st
d
::unique_l
o
c
k
definit
i
on to a s
e
parate
header
commit
|
commitdiff
|
tree
2018-07-24
r
e
di
Ad
d
i
nitial version of C++17
<memory_resource>
h
e
a
der
commit
|
commitdiff
|
tree
2018-07-24
redi
PR libstdc++/86658
f
i
x
__
n
iter_wrap
t
o
not copy invali
d
.
.
.
commit
|
commitdiff
|
tree
2018-07-24
red
i
Minor
r
efactori
n
g in <b
i
t>
header
commit
|
commitdiff
|
tree
2018-07-24
r
edi
Reorder conditio
n
s
in
uses-all
o
cator cons
t
ructi
o
n helpe
r
commit
|
commitdiff
|
tree
2018-07-24
r
edi
Make __resource_a
d
aptor_imp usabl
e
with C++17 memory_
r
esou
r
ce
commit
|
commitdiff
|
tree
2018-07-24
redi
PR libstdc
+
+/
7
0966
f
ix lifetime bug
f
or default resource
commit
|
commitdiff
|
tree
2018-07-23
re
d
i
P
R libstdc++/70940 o
p
ti
m
ize pmr
:
:
re
s
ource
_
ada
p
to
r
for
.
.
.
commit
|
commitdiff
|
tree
2018-07-20
redi
PR
l
ibstdc+
+
/86595 add missing n
o
except
commit
|
commitdiff
|
tree
2018-07-20
redi
Use defau
l
t visibility to work around
c
lang
-
fvisibilit
y
.
.
.
commit
|
commitdiff
|
tree
2018-07-20
redi
PR l
i
b
s
tdc++/86603 Mo
v
e
__cpp_lib_list_remo
v
e
_
r
eturn_type
.
.
.
commit
|
commitdiff
|
tree
2018-07-19
r
ed
i
Simpl
i
fy the base
c
haracteristics f
o
r some type
t
raits
commit
|
commitdiff
|
tree
2018-07-19
redi
Use __buil
t
in_
m
e
mmove for triviall
y
copyable types
commit
|
commitdiff
|
tree
2018-07-17
redi
PR libstdc
+
+/86450 use
-
Wabi=2
a
n
d simpl
i
fy
-
We
r
ror use
commit
|
commitdiff
|
tree
2018-07-17
redi
Rem
o
ve unu
s
ed explic
i
t inst
a
ntiation of __bind_sim
p
l
e
commit
|
commitdiff
|
tree
2018-07-16
redi
* scripts/
c
reate_testsu
i
te_files: Fix typo in comment
.
commit
|
commitdiff
|
tree
2018-07-16
r
e
d
i
P
R libstdc++/8653
7
re
m
ove less<sha
r
ed_ptr
<
T>>
p
ar
t
i
a
l
.
.
.
commit
|
commitdiff
|
tree
2018-07-06
redi
P
R libst
d
c
+
+
/
8
49
2
8
use s
t
d::move
i
n <nu
m
eri
c
> algorithms
commit
|
commitdiff
|
tree
2018-07-06
redi
Si
m
p
l
ify linker scri
p
t
pattern
s
for std::excepti
o
n
_
ptr
commit
|
commitdiff
|
tree
2018-07-06
redi
P0935R0 Er
a
dic
a
ti
n
g unne
c
e
ssarily explicit
default
.
.
.
commit
|
commitdiff
|
tree
2018-07-06
redi
*
i
nclude/std/varia
n
t (__accepted
_
index): Use
v
o
i
d
_t
.
commit
|
commitdiff
|
tree
2018-07-05
redi
PR libstdc++/85
8
3
1
define mo
v
e
construc
t
ors a
n
d
operato
r
s
.
.
.
commit
|
commitdiff
|
tree
2018-07-05
redi
Add xfail-if to some tests
t
hat fail with
C
OW stri
n
g
s
commit
|
commitdiff
|
tree
2018-07-05
re
d
i
P
R libstd
c
++
/
58265 add noe
x
cept to basi
c
_strin
g
:
:assign
.
.
.
commit
|
commitdiff
|
tree
2018-07-05
r
e
d
i
PR li
b
stdc++/58265
i
mplement LWG 2
0
63 fo
r
COW str
i
n
gs
commit
|
commitdiff
|
tree
2018-07-04
redi
P06
4
6R
1
Im
p
roving the Re
t
u
rn Value of Erase-Like Algo
r
i
thms I
commit
|
commitdiff
|
tree
2018-07-04
red
i
P0458R2 Checking for Exi
s
tence
o
f
an Element in
Associative
.
.
.
commit
|
commitdiff
|
tree
2018-07-04
redi
D
e
fine "random_
d
evice"
effecti
v
e target
commit
|
commitdiff
|
tree
2018-07-04
redi
Fix std::__r
o
t
l
and s
t
d:
:
__rot
r
commit
|
commitdiff
|
tree
2018-07-04
redi
PR libstdc++/86398 fix s
t
d::is_trivial
l
y
_
c
o
n
s
tructible
.
.
.
commit
|
commitdiff
|
tree
2018-07-04
redi
Op
t
imize std:
:
rotl and std::rotr, add test fo
r
s
td
.
.
.
commit
|
commitdiff
|
tree
2018-07-03
r
e
d
i
P05
5
6
R3 Integ
r
a
l pow
e
r
-
o
f-2 operations,
P
055
3
R2 Bit
.
.
.
commit
|
commitdiff
|
tree
2018-07-03
r
e
d
i
Remove redundant #i
f
conditional
commit
|
commitdiff
|
tree
2018-07-02
redi
P0758R1 Implicit con
v
er
s
i
o
n tra
i
t
s
commit
|
commitdiff
|
tree
2018-07-02
re
d
i
P08
8
7
R
1 T
h
e identity meta
f
unction
commit
|
commitdiff
|
tree
2018-07-02
redi
O
p
timi
z
e
s
td::su
b
_matc
h
comparisons u
s
ing string_
v
iew
.
.
.
commit
|
commitdiff
|
tree
2018-06-29
redi
Add whitespace to some dejagnu directi
v
es
i
n l
i
b
stdc
.
.
.
commit
|
commitdiff
|
tree
2018-06-27
r
ed
i
Add st
d
:
:__is_byte
<
std::byt
e
> specializatio
n
commit
|
commitdiff
|
tree
2018-06-27
redi
D
e
cla
r
e
some ex
p
lic
i
t ins
t
antiat
i
o
n
s
for
strings
i
n
.
.
.
commit
|
commitdiff
|
tree
2018-06-26
redi
Add missing n
o
ex
c
e
p
t o
n
definition t
o
ma
t
ch declaration
commit
|
commitdiff
|
tree
2018-06-25
re
d
i
PR libs
t
d
c
++/8
6
1
1
2 fix printers for Python 2
.
6
commit
|
commitdiff
|
tree
2018-06-25
redi
Update powerpc6
4
-linu
x
-gnu/
b
aseline_symbols
.
txt
commit
|
commitdiff
|
tree
2018-06-25
redi
PR libstdc++/86292 fix exception
s
a
f
ety of s
t
d::ve
c
tor
.
.
.
commit
|
commitdiff
|
tree
2018-06-25
red
i
* doc/xml/ma
n
u
al/status
_
cxx2017
.
xml: Document N45
3
1
.
.
.
commit
|
commitdiff
|
tree
2018-06-25
redi
Add experimental::sample and experim
e
n
t
al::
s
h
uf
f
le
.
.
.
commit
|
commitdiff
|
tree
2018-06-22
redi
Fi
x
unexported b
a
sic_string
s
y
mbols for 32-bit targets
commit
|
commitdiff
|
tree
2018-06-22
red
i
PR
libstdc++/
8
6280 fix u
n
defin
e
d left
s
hi
f
t on 32-bit
.
.
.
commit
|
commitdiff
|
tree
2018-06-21
re
d
i
PR libstdc++/8613
8
preve
n
t implici
t
instan
t
i
at
i
on of
.
.
.
commit
|
commitdiff
|
tree
2018-06-21
redi
PR libstdc++/
8
33
2
8 add correct basic
_
st
r
ing
:
:insert
.
.
.
commit
|
commitdiff
|
tree
2018-06-21
redi
* config/abi/post/x
8
6_64-lin
u
x-gnu
/
baseline_symbol
s
.
.
.
commit
|
commitdiff
|
tree
2018-06-21
redi
PR libstdc++/70940 make pmr
:
:res
o
u
rce_adaptor r
e
tu
r
n
.
.
.
commit
|
commitdiff
|
tree
2018-06-21
redi
PR lib
s
tdc++/70940 ma
k
e pmr::resource_
a
da
p
tor return
.
.
.
commit
|
commitdiff
|
tree
2018-06-20
redi
PR libst
d
c++/70966 make
pmr
:
:
new
_
del
e
te_resource(
)
.
.
.
commit
|
commitdiff
|
tree
2018-06-20
r
edi
Add testc
a
se acc
i
denta
l
ly not committed earlier
commit
|
commitdiff
|
tree
2018-06-19
re
d
i
R
emo
v
e unuse
d
<exception> header from <utility>
commit
|
commitdiff
|
tree
2018-06-18
redi
LWG 2
9
75 ensu
r
e
construct
(
pair<T,U>*,
.
.
.
)
u
s
e
d
t
o
.
.
.
commit
|
commitdiff
|
tree
2018-06-18
redi
LWG 2989 hid
e
path iostream operators from normal
l
oo
k
up
commit
|
commitdiff
|
tree
2018-06-18
redi
LWG 30
5
0 Fix cv-qualification of convertibility cons
t
raints
commit
|
commitdiff
|
tree
2018-06-18
re
d
i
P
0
754R2 <versio
n
> h
e
ader
commit
|
commitdiff
|
tree
2018-06-18
redi
F
ix bootstra
p
failure for b
a
r
e metal due
t
o autoconf
.
.
.
commit
|
commitdiff
|
tree
2018-06-18
red
i
L
W
G
303
5
.
std::allocator
'
s
c
o
n
stru
c
tor
s
should be constexpr
commit
|
commitdiff
|
tree
2018-06-15
re
d
i
LW
G
3
0
76 basic_str
i
n
g
CTAD ambigui
t
y
commit
|
commitdiff
|
tree
2018-06-15
redi
PR
libstdc+
+
/86169 unshare C
O
W string when non-const
.
.
.
commit
|
commitdiff
|
tree
2018-06-15
r
edi
Decorate strin
g
_vi
e
w m
e
mbers wi
t
h nonnull attrib
u
te
commit
|
commitdiff
|
tree
2018-06-15
redi
PR
l
i
b
stdc++/
8
6
1
6
8 fi
x
ambiguou
s
d
efault c
o
nstructor
commit
|
commitdiff
|
tree
2018-06-15
redi
Onl
y
define __cpp
_
lib_c
o
ns
t
expr_char_
t
r
a
i
ts for C++1
7
commit
|
commitdiff
|
tree
2018-06-15
r
e
di
LW
G
2993 reference_wrapper<T> conversion f
r
o
m T&&
commit
|
commitdiff
|
tree
2018-06-15
r
edi
LWG 30
3
9
Unn
e
cessary decay in thread and package
d
_task
commit
|
commitdiff
|
tree
2018-06-14
redi
L
WG
3075
b
asic_string
n
ee
d
s deduction guides
from basic_stri
.
.
.
commit
|
commitdiff
|
tree
2018-06-14
r
e
di
LWG 3074
m
ake scalar type
s
non-ded
u
ced i
n
valarray
.
.
.
commit
|
commitdiff
|
tree
2018-06-14
redi
Partially revert move
of std
:
:
t
upl
e
_
elem
e
nt_t
to <tuple>
commit
|
commitdiff
|
tree
2018-06-14
r
e
di
P
0
935R0 Era
d
icating
unnecessa
r
ily explicit
d
ef
a
ult
.
.
.
commit
|
commitdiff
|
tree
next